Serves: 4
Ingredients
2 stalks of lemongrass, trimmed and slice thinly
5 large cloves garlic, peeled
2 teaspoons white peppercorns
2 cilantro roots or 2 tablespoons finely-chopped cilantro stems
One chicken (weighing 2.5-3 pounds), spatchcocked and halved
2 tablespoons oyster sauce
2 tablespoons fish sauce
3 tablespoons packed grated palm sugar or 2 tablespoons packed brown sugar
Instructions
Make a fine paste out of the sliced lemongrass, garlic, peppercorns, cilantro roots using a mortar or a mini-chopper.
Put the chicken in a large mixing bowl and prick it all over with a fork.
Add the aromatic paste to the chicken along with the remaining ingredients. Rub the seasoning into every nook and cranny of the chicken.
Cover and chill for 3-4 hours.
Grill over low heat for about 30-35 minutes until golden brown and juices run clear.
